Home
last modified time | relevance | path

Searched refs:DirectOutputThread (Results 1 – 6 of 6) sorted by relevance

/aosp12/frameworks/av/services/audioflinger/
H A DThreads.h1479 class DirectOutputThread : public PlaybackThread {
1482 DirectOutputThread(const sp<AudioFlinger>& audioFlinger, AudioStreamOut* output, in DirectOutputThread() function
1484 : DirectOutputThread(audioFlinger, output, id, DIRECT, systemReady) { } in DirectOutputThread()
1486 virtual ~DirectOutputThread();
1518 DirectOutputThread(const sp<AudioFlinger>& audioFlinger, AudioStreamOut* output,
1554 class OffloadThread : public DirectOutputThread {
H A DThreads.cpp6046 AudioFlinger::DirectOutputThread::DirectOutputThread(const sp<AudioFlinger>& audioFlinger, in DirectOutputThread() function in android::AudioFlinger::DirectOutputThread
6053 AudioFlinger::DirectOutputThread::~DirectOutputThread() in ~DirectOutputThread()
6127 void AudioFlinger::DirectOutputThread::onAddNewTrack_l() in onAddNewTrack_l()
6363 void AudioFlinger::DirectOutputThread::threadLoop_mix() in threadLoop_mix()
6390 void AudioFlinger::DirectOutputThread::threadLoop_sleepTime() in threadLoop_sleepTime()
6406 void AudioFlinger::DirectOutputThread::threadLoop_exit() in threadLoop_exit()
6424 bool AudioFlinger::DirectOutputThread::shouldStandby_l() in shouldStandby_l()
6493 uint32_t AudioFlinger::DirectOutputThread::idleSleepTimeUs() const in idleSleepTimeUs()
6515 void AudioFlinger::DirectOutputThread::cacheParameters_l() in cacheParameters_l()
6531 void AudioFlinger::DirectOutputThread::flushHw_l() in flushHw_l()
[all …]
H A DPlaybackTracks.h203 friend class DirectOutputThread; variable
H A DAudioFlinger.h562 class DirectOutputThread; variable
H A DTracks.cpp1342 DirectOutputThread *directOutputThread = static_cast<DirectOutputThread*>(thread.get()); in selectPresentation()
H A DAudioFlinger.cpp2592 thread = new DirectOutputThread(this, outputStream, *output, mSystemReady); in openOutput_l()